JACKSONVILLE, Fla. -- The commander of a reserve battalion based in Jacksonville has been relieved of duty.
Capt. Sean McDonell has been relieved due to a loss in confidence, mismanagement and major program deficiencies. McDonell led the Naval Mobile Construction Battalion (NMCB) 14.
Commander Todd Smith will take over on an interim basis until Commander Mark Williams steps in next summer.
NMCB 14 is a Seabee reserve unit in Jacksonville. The unit builds roads, bridges, bunkers, airfields, and logistical bases. It also helps with global humanitarian efforts.
